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Kurnool to Colombo is to train and ferry which costs Rs. 25000 - Rs. 41000 and takes 31h 27m.
The fastest way to get from Kurnool to Colombo is to bus and fly which takes 8h 27m and costs Rs. 45000 - Rs. 150000.
The distance between Kurnool and Colombo is 1388 km.
The best way to get from Kurnool to Colombo without a car is to train and ferry which takes 31h 27m and costs Rs. 25000 - Rs. 41000.
It takes approximately 8h 37m to get from Kurnool to Colombo, including transfers.
There are 1465+ hotels available in Colombo.
What companies run services between Kurnool, India and Colombo, Sri Lanka?
There is no direct connection from Kurnool to Colombo. However, you can take the train to Umdanagar, walk to Shamsabad, take the bus to Rajiv Gandhi International Airport, walk to Hyderabad (HYD) airport, fly to Bandaranaike International Airport (CMB), then take the taxi to Colombo. Alternatively, you can take a train from Kurnool City to Colombo Fort via Yerraguntla, Nagappattinam, Nagapattinam, Kankesanturai, and Kankesanturai in around 31h 27m.
